Repository: deltaspike Updated Branches: refs/heads/master 5b2d19379 -> 38a17fe52
DELTASPIKE-370 - Add test-utils dependencies (maven-artifact) as an AuxiliaryArchiveAppender Project: http://git-wip-us.apache.org/repos/asf/deltaspike/repo Commit: http://git-wip-us.apache.org/repos/asf/deltaspike/commit/38a17fe5 Tree: http://git-wip-us.apache.org/repos/asf/deltaspike/tree/38a17fe5 Diff: http://git-wip-us.apache.org/repos/asf/deltaspike/diff/38a17fe5 Branch: refs/heads/master Commit: 38a17fe52aff949517aa88ff42732034e0f18437 Parents: 5b2d193 Author: Rafael Benevides <[email protected]> Authored: Wed Jun 4 16:23:53 2014 -0300 Committer: Rafael Benevides <[email protected]> Committed: Wed Jun 4 16:23:53 2014 -0300 ---------------------------------------------------------------------- .../arquillian/DeltaSpikeTestUtilExtension.java | 1 + .../TestUtilDependenciesAppender.java | 33 ++++++++++++++++++++ 2 files changed, 34 insertions(+)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/deltaspike/blob/38a17fe5/deltaspike/test-utils/src/main/java/org/apache/deltaspike/test/arquillian/DeltaSpikeTestUtilExtension.java ---------------------------------------------------------------------- diff --git a/deltaspike/test-utils/src/main/java/org/apache/deltaspike/test/arquillian/DeltaSpikeTestUtilExtension.java b/deltaspike/test-utils/src/main/java/org/apache/deltaspike/test/arquillian/DeltaSpikeTestUtilExtension.java index ee795be..ffc9e0f 100644 --- a/deltaspike/test-utils/src/main/java/org/apache/deltaspike/test/arquillian/DeltaSpikeTestUtilExtension.java +++ b/deltaspike/test-utils/src/main/java/org/apache/deltaspike/test/arquillian/DeltaSpikeTestUtilExtension.java @@ -27,5 +27,6 @@ public class DeltaSpikeTestUtilExtension implements LoadableExtension public void register(final ExtensionBuilder extensionBuilder) { extensionBuilder.service(AuxiliaryArchiveAppender.class, DeltaSpikeServerUtilAppender.class); + extensionBuilder.service(AuxiliaryArchiveAppender.class, TestUtilDependenciesAppender.class); } } http://git-wip-us.apache.org/repos/asf/deltaspike/blob/38a17fe5/deltaspike/test-utils/src/main/java/org/apache/deltaspike/test/arquillian/TestUtilDependenciesAppender.java ---------------------------------------------------------------------- diff --git a/deltaspike/test-utils/src/main/java/org/apache/deltaspike/test/arquillian/TestUtilDependenciesAppender.java b/deltaspike/test-utils/src/main/java/org/apache/deltaspike/test/arquillian/TestUtilDependenciesAppender.java new file mode 100644 index 0000000..9c7373d --- /dev/null +++ b/deltaspike/test-utils/src/main/java/org/apache/deltaspike/test/arquillian/TestUtilDependenciesAppender.java @@ -0,0 +1,33 @@ +/* + * Licensed to the Apache Software Foundation (ASF) under one + * or more contributor license agreements. See the NOTICE file + * distributed with this work for additional information + * regarding copyright ownership. The ASF licenses this file + * to you under the Apache License, Version 2.0 (the + * "License"); you may not use this file except in compliance + * with the License. You may obtain a copy of the License at + * + * http://www.apache.org/licenses/LICENSE-2.0 + * + * Unless required by applicable law or agreed to in writing, + * software distributed under the License is distributed on an + * "AS IS" BASIS, WITHOUT WARRANTIES OR CONDITIONS OF ANY + * KIND, either express or implied. See the License for the + * specific language governing permissions and limitations + * under the License. + */ +package org.apache.deltaspike.test.arquillian; + +import org.jboss.arquillian.container.test.spi.client.deployment.CachedAuxilliaryArchiveAppender; +import org.jboss.shrinkwrap.api.Archive; +import org.jboss.shrinkwrap.api.ShrinkWrap; +import org.jboss.shrinkwrap.api.spec.JavaArchive; + +public class TestUtilDependenciesAppender extends CachedAuxilliaryArchiveAppender +{ + @Override + protected Archive<?> buildArchive() + { + return ShrinkWrap.create(JavaArchive.class, "maven-artifact").addPackage("org.apache.maven.artifact.versioning"); + } +}
